TypeScript SDK for x402 HTTP payments by Primer. OpenClaw compatible 🦞
Easily add pay-per-request monetization to your JavaScript/TypeScript APIs using the x402 protocol. Accept stablecoin payments (USDC, EURC) or any ERC-20 token with gasless transactions—payers never pay gas fees.
Quick Start (CLI)
# Create a new wallet
xclaw02 wallet create
# Check balance
xclaw02 wallet balance 0xYourAddress
# Probe a URL for x402 support
xclaw02 probe https://api.example.com/paid
# Set up for OpenClaw
xclaw02 openclaw initWhy x402?
- HTTP-native payments - Uses the standard HTTP 402 Payment Required status code
- Gasless for payers - Payments are authorized via EIP-712 signatures; facilitators handle gas
- Stablecoin support - Native support for USDC/EURC via EIP-3009
transferWithAuthorization - Any ERC-20 token - Support for other tokens via Primer's Prism settlement contract
- Multi-chain - Base, Ethereum, Arbitrum, Optimism, Polygon (mainnet + testnet)
- Framework integrations - Express, Hono, Next.js middleware included
- Testing utilities - Mock facilitator for integration testing

});Token Types
EIP-3009 Tokens (USDC, EURC)
These tokens support gasless transfers natively via transferWithAuthorization. The payer signs an authorization, and the facilitator executes the transfer—payer pays zero gas.
Standard ERC-20 Tokens
For other ERC-20 tokens, Primer's Prism contract enables gasless payments:
- One-time approval - Approve the Prism contract to spend your tokens
- Gasless payments - Sign authorizations; Prism handles the transfers
const { createSigner, approveToken } = require('xclaw02');
const signer = await createSigner('eip155:8453', process.env.PRIVATE_KEY);
// One-time approval (this transaction requires gas)
await approveToken(signer, '0xTokenAddress');
// Now you can make gasless payments with this tokenNetworks
Networks use CAIP-2 identifiers (e.g., eip155:8453 for Base).
| Network (CAIP-2) | Chain ID | Legacy Name | Default Facilitator | |------------------|----------|-------------|---------------------| | eip155:8453 | 8453 | base | ✓ Primer | | eip155:84532 | 84532 | base-sepolia | ✓ Primer | | eip155:1 | 1 | ethereum | Custom required | | eip155:11155111 | 11155111 | sepolia | Custom required | | eip155:42161 | 42161 | arbitrum | Custom required | | eip155:421614 | 421614 | arbitrum-sepolia | Custom required | | eip155:10 | 10 | optimism | Custom required | | eip155:11155420 | 11155420 | optimism-sepolia | Custom required | | eip155:137 | 137 | polygon | Custom required | | eip155:80002 | 80002 | polygon-amoy | Custom required |
Note: Legacy network names (e.g.,
'base') are still accepted for backward compatibility but CAIP-2 format is recommended.

The SDK provides testing utilities to help you test your x402 integration without making real payments. Import from xclaw02/testing:
const {
createMockFacilitator,
createTestPayment,
createTest402Response,
fixtures
} = require('xclaw02/testing');What's Provided
| Utility | Purpose |
|---------|---------|
| createMockFacilitator() | Fake payment server that approves/rejects without blockchain |
| createTestPayment() | Generate valid X-PAYMENT headers without a real wallet |
| createTest402Response() | Generate 402 responses for testing client code |
| fixtures | Pre-built test addresses, route configs, and sample payloads |

}Error Handling
The SDK provides structured errors for programmatic handling:
const { X402Error, ErrorCodes } = require('xclaw02');
try {
const response = await x402Fetch(url, signer, { maxAmount: '0.10' });
} catch (error) {
if (error instanceof X402Error) {
switch (error.code) {
case ErrorCodes.INSUFFICIENT_FUNDS:
console.log('Need more funds:', error.details);
break;
case ErrorCodes.AMOUNT_EXCEEDS_MAX:
console.log('Payment too expensive:', error.details);
break;
case ErrorCodes.SETTLEMENT_FAILED:
console.log('Settlement failed:', error.details);
break;
}
}
}Error Codes
| Code | Description |
|------|-------------|
| INVALID_CONFIG | Missing or invalid configuration |
| MISSING_PRIVATE_KEY | Private key not provided |
| UNSUPPORTED_NETWORK | Network not supported |
| INSUFFICIENT_FUNDS | Wallet balance too low |
| AMOUNT_EXCEEDS_MAX | Payment exceeds maxAmount |
| PAYMENT_FAILED | Payment transaction failed |
| SETTLEMENT_FAILED | Facilitator settlement failed |
| INVALID_RESPONSE | Malformed 402 response |
| MISSING_PAYMENT_HEADER | No payment requirements header |
